Average Physicians, All Other Salary in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R
Physicians, All Other in the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R area earn an average annual salary of $236,460. This figure is slightly below the national average of $256,170, suggesting that while the demand for specialized medical professionals is present, local market dynamics and potentially other factors contribute to this compensation level. The specific economic landscape and healthcare infrastructure of the region play a crucial role in shaping these salary outcomes.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$236,460 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 52.7%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$354,690.
- Outlook: The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R metropolitan area supports a local workforce of 1,020 Physicians, All Other. With a jobs-per-1,000-workers ratio of 2.884, the presence of these professionals is notable within the local employment fabric. The concentration, indicated by a Location Quotient of 1.41, suggests a higher-than-average presence of these roles compared to the national landscape, pointing towards a robust and potentially growing demand for their expertise in the region.

How much does a Physicians, All Other make in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R?
The median annual salary for a Physicians, All Other in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R is $236,460. This typically ranges from $63,770 for entry-level positions to $354,690 for top-level roles.
How does the salary compare to the national average?
The average salary for this role in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R is 7.7% lower than the national median of $256,170.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 1,020 employees in the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way, AR area with a job density of 2.884 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
